Lineups for Mighty Mighty Bosstones' "Hometown Throwdown"
December 26, 2008 Cambridge, Massachusetts Middle East Westbound Train, Roll The Tanks
December 27, 2008 Cambridge, Massachusetts Middle East The Big Bad Bollocks, Have Nots
December 28, 2008 Cambridge, Massachusetts Middle East Slapshot, The Attack
December 29, 2008 Cambridge, Massachusetts Middle East Big D, the Kids Table and Vagiant
December 30, 2008 New Haven, Connecticut Toad's Place Tip The Van, The Murder Mile
December 31, 2008 Providence, Rhode Island Lupos The Agents, Far From Finished, The Cobramatics
